Pre-season has seen the usual coming and goings at the Lane as the club prepare for the new season.

The Management team have been busy over the summer with six players joining the club.

Ben Sawyer returns having finished last season with Barton Rovers. The 21 year old attacker originally signed for Soham at the beginning of the 2013/14 season from Huntingdon Town, scoring twelve goals in forty-nine games, before leaving last summer for Histon.

David Theobald has arrived from Southern League Royston Town. The 36 year old experience defender played in the Football League for Brentford, Swansea City and Cambridge United, before spells with Canvey Island, Kettering Town and Cambridge City.

Goalkeeper Harry Reynolds signs following his release from Cheltenham Town. The 19 year never made a competitive appearance for the Robins but was often named on the substitute bench. Harry originally began his career with Royston Town, and last season had a loan spell with Cambridge City.

The club have also signed three players from the Kershaw League with midfielder Simon Swinton and versatile Josh Townshend joining from League champions Great Shelford, whilst striker Dale Archer arrives from Linton Granta having scored twenty-two goals in twenty-three appearances.
Like Soham, Dale was also commended in the recent FA Respect awards, winning the people’s award after deliberately missing a penalty he felt had been unjustly awarded in his side's match with Brampton last season.

As well as the new additions to the squad, the vast majority of last season’s squad have re-signed for the new campaign, including top goal scorer Luke Stanley, who despite offers from higher level clubs has decided to stay at Soham.
Also returning are Jordan Baker, Jordan Gent, Marcus Hall, Alex Luque, Andy Palmer, Rob Ruddy, Callum Russell, Charlie Russell and Ryan Sharman.

The club can also confirm that Joey Abbs has left and signed for Thurlow Nunn Premier Division Newmarket Town. The attacker joined the Greens in October 2013 from Cambridge City scoring seventeen goals in fifty-six appearances.

New Reserve Team Manager Wayne Lockwood and his coaches have also been busy building a side ahead of the season, with a number of new players arriving at the club.
Jordan Sharpe and Dan Gawthrop join from Newmarket Town, whilst Robbie Scrivener (Burwell Swifts), Ben Tuffs (Fordham) and Scott Hayes (Wickhambrook) have also signed, along with a number of returning players from last season.
